  • Publication number: 20110165577
    Abstract: The present invention relates to method for determining whether a gastrointestinal cancer patient is likely to experience a disease recurrence, said method comprising steps of determining concentration of TIMP-1 in a pre-operative plasma sample of said patient, and determining the concentration of CEA in a pre-operative body fluid sample of said patient, and evaluate whether the patient as likely to experience a disease recurrence. The present invention further provides kits for application of said methods.

  • Publication number: 20110144047
    Abstract: The invention provides methods for predicting the response to a topoisomerase Il? inhibitor therapy in an individual having cancer, wherein the methods comprise the steps of determining TIMP-I DNA aberration/TIMP-1 protein aberration in combination with determining DNA aberration in TOP2A/HER2 amplicon on chromosome 17q21 including TOP2A and HER2 or aberrations of TOP2A and ErbB2 protein expression. Further provided are methods of treating cancer by using said topoisomerase Il? inhibitor therapy. The invention also comprises a kit for the application of the methods for predicting the response to a topoisomerase Il? inhibitor therapy in an individual having cancer.
